Q

Describe how HIV is replicated

A

1 attachment proteins attach to receptors on helper T cell
2 nucleic acid enters cell
3 reverse transcriptase coverts RNA to DNA
4 viral protein produced

Q

Describe how HIV is replicated once inside helper T cells

A

1 RNA converted into DNA using reverse transcriptase
2 DNA incorporated into helper T cell DNA
3 DNA transcribed into HIV mRNA
4 HIV mRNA translated into new viral proteins (for assembly into viral particles)

Q

Explain how HIV affects the production of antibodies when AIDS develops in a person.

A

1 less antibody produced
2 because HIV destroys helper T cells
3 so few B cells activated

Q

Describe the structure of the human immunodeficiency virus

A

1 RNA as genetic material
2 reverse transcriptase
3 protein capsid
4 phospholipid envelope
5 attachment proteins
